Kind of an odd question, but does anyone have an idea of what a '69 fastback weighs fully stripped down? And by stripped I mean no suspension, windows, complete teardown restoration. I'm trying to decide if I should pull the suspension before I have the car media blasted, but I wasnt sure if we'd be able to manage the weight of the body with just a few people lifting it.

At least 500-600 pounds would be my guess--probably somewhat more. Look at my avatar. I can pick it up on one end (barely) by myself to scoot it sideways. I can move it by myself up the driveway into the garage, but not easily especially over the transition from driveway to garage. The problem is the are really awkward and hard to hold onto when trying to lift. The cart my car is on was made out of 2x2" steel tubing, the mounting points are the lower control arm bolts in front and the rear leaf spring front eye mount.

If I had to do over again, I would definitely take it all the way down as I did. That makes it easy to get ALL of it clean the first time.
